s390/io: Add pci_iomap_wc() and pci_iomap_wc_range()

The following commit:

  1b3d4200c1e0 ("PCI: Add pci_iomap_wc() variants")

Introduced pci_iomap_wc() variants but broke the s390 build,
because s390 requires its own implementation of pcio_iomap*()
calls.

The reason for that is that:

  "BAR spaces are not disjunctive on s390 so we need the bar
   parameter of pci_iomap to find the corresponding device
   and create the mapping cookie"

so it has its own lookup/lock solution and it does not include
asm-generic/pci_iomap.h.

Since it currenty maps ioremap_wc() to ioremap_nocache() and
that's the architecture default we can easily just map the wc
calls to the default calls as well.

 arch/s390/include/asm/io.h |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/s390/include/asm/io.h b/arch/s390/include/asm/io.h
index cb5fdf3..437e9af 100644
--- a/arch/s390/include/asm/io.h
+++ b/arch/s390/include/asm/io.h
@@ -57,6 +57,8 @@ static inline void ioport_unmap(void __iomem *p)
  */
 #define pci_iomap pci_iomap
 #define pci_iounmap pci_iounmap
+#define pci_iomap_wc pci_iomap
+#define pci_iomap_wc_range pci_iomap_range
 
 #define memcpy_fromio(dst, src, count) zpci_memcpy_fromio(dst, src, count)
 #define memcpy_toio(dst, src, count)   zpci_memcpy_toio(dst, src, count)
